返回
数据可视化利器:DolphinDB前端图表组件的巧妙应用
开发工具
2023-09-27 01:05:52
在当今信息时代,数据可视化发挥着至关重要的作用。它能够将复杂难懂的数据转化为直观易懂的图表,帮助人们快速理解数据背后的含义。在物联网和实时监控等场景中,数据图表更是必不可少的元素。
本文将向您介绍如何通过DolphinDB的Web数据接口和JavaScript将DolphinDB中的数据可视化地展现出来。DolphinDB是一款开源的分布式数据库,它具有强大的数据处理能力和丰富的可视化功能。通过使用DolphinDB,您可以轻松实现数据可视化,为您的项目增添直观性和洞察力。
1. 连接数据库
首先,我们需要连接到DolphinDB数据库。可以使用DolphinDB提供的客户端工具,如DolphinDB Shell或DolphinDB Studio,也可以通过Web浏览器连接。
// 使用DolphinDB Shell连接数据库
const connection = new dolphindb.Connection("localhost", 8848, "admin", "123456");
// 使用Web浏览器连接数据库
const connection = new dolphindb.Connection("http://localhost:8848", "admin", "123456");
2. 创建图表
连接到数据库后,就可以开始创建图表了。DolphinDB提供了多种图表类型,如折线图、柱状图、饼图等。您可以根据自己的需要选择合适的图表类型。
// 创建一个折线图
const chart = new dolphindb.Chart("line");
// 设置图表标题
chart.setTitle("折线图示例");
// 设置图表数据
chart.setData([
{
name: "January",
value: 100
},
{
name: "February",
value: 200
},
{
name: "March",
value: 300
}
]);
// 渲染图表
chart.render("chart-container");
3. 其他操作
除了创建图表之外,您还可以对图表进行其他操作,如更改图表类型、修改图表数据、添加交互功能等。
// 更改图表类型
chart.setType("bar");
// 修改图表数据
chart.setData([
{
name: "Q1",
value: 100
},
{
name: "Q2",
value: 200
},
{
name: "Q3",
value: 300
}
]);
// 添加交互功能
chart.addInteraction("zoom");
chart.addInteraction("pan");
4. 结语
通过本文的介绍,您已经了解了如何使用DolphinDB的Web数据接口和JavaScript将DolphinDB中的数据可视化地展现出来。DolphinDB是一款功能强大的数据库,它提供了丰富的可视化功能,您可以轻松实现数据可视化,为您的项目增添直观性和洞察力。